		<description>I enjoyed the film and the non-linear concept and storylines. But I thought the performances by the young actors, J.D. Pardo and the actress in the role of young Mariana, were especially good. I thought they were raw, naive, innocent, complicated and simple all in appropriate places. Young Mariana&#039;s reaction to the fire was especially good and well-paced. I didn&#039;t really care about Basinger&#039;s character because I had no understanding of why she was having an affair in the first place. Theron&#039;s performance was also good, and I appreciated it even more when the plotlines finally came together because I understood the character&#039;s choices. I too think I might get even more from the film if I saw it a second time. I wanted the film to go on another five minutes or so to see the reunion of Santiago and Mariana.</description>
